Digital transformation initiatives have also contributed significantly to ITAM adoption. As organizations embrace new technologies such as artificial intelligence, Internet of Things (IoT), and automation, the volume and variety of IT assets increase dramatically. Managing this growing complexity manually becomes impractical, making ITAM software an essential tool for ensuring efficiency and scalability. By leveraging AI and predictive analytics, modern ITAM solutions can provide actionable insights into asset performance, anticipate hardware failures, and recommend optimal allocation of resources. This predictive capability not only reduces costs but also improves service delivery and end-user satisfaction.

The need for operational efficiency is another important factor driving ITAM adoption. Organizations that lack centralized asset management often experience delays in procurement, maintenance, and support processes. ITAM software streamlines these workflows by automating inventory management, tracking asset assignments, and integrating with helpdesk systems. This results in faster response times, improved asset utilization, and reduced operational overhead. Employees can quickly access information about hardware and software availability, while IT teams can make data-driven decisions regarding upgrades, replacements, and procurement. Consequently, ITAM contributes to smoother operations and better resource management across the organization.

Additionally, sustainability and environmental considerations are increasingly influencing ITAM adoption. Organizations are adopting green IT practices to reduce electronic waste, extend hardware lifecycles, and implement energy-efficient operations. ITAM software supports these initiatives by tracking asset lifecycles, enabling the reuse and recycling of hardware, and providing visibility into energy consumption patterns. By aligning IT management with sustainability goals, businesses can reduce their environmental footprint, achieve cost savings, and enhance their corporate social responsibility profile. This focus on sustainable IT management further underscores the importance of ITAM solutions in modern enterprises.
